✨ Quick Comparison Table
App Name | Loan Amount | Interest Rate (Annual) | Disbursal Time | RBI Regulated | Eligibility |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
KreditBee | ₹500 – ₹1,00,000 | 16% – 29.95% | < 10 minutes | Yes | Salaried & self-employed |
Fibe (formerly EarlySalary) | ₹1,000 – ₹5,00,000 | 18% – 30% | 10-15 minutes | Yes | Salaried professionals |
Nira | ₹3,000 – ₹1,00,000 | 24% onwards | < 24 hours | Yes | Salaried (min ₹12,000) |
CASHe | ₹1,000 – ₹3,00,000 | 27% – 33% | < 20 minutes | Yes | Salaried only |
Kissht | ₹5,000 – ₹1,00,000 | 14% – 30% | 10-20 minutes | Yes | Salaried & Business Owners |

2. Fibe (EarlySalary) – Best for Salaried Professionals
Why it stands out: Fibe (rebranded from EarlySalary) offers flexible personal loans and salary advances with minimal paperwork.
- Loan range: ₹1,000 to ₹5,00,000
- Interest rate: 18% to 30% p.a.
- Tenure: 3 to 60 months
- RBI Regulated: Yes (Social Worth Technologies Pvt Ltd)
- Pros: High loan limit, fast approval, zero prepayment charges
- Cons: Requires credit score above 650
Good For: Professionals with steady income who want flexibility and larger amounts.
3. Nira – Best for First-Time Borrowers
Why it stands out: Nira helps people with moderate incomes and thin credit files access loans with low barriers.
- Loan range: ₹3,000 to ₹1,00,000
- Interest rate: 24% onwards
- Tenure: 3 to 24 months
- RBI Registered NBFC Partner: Yes (Wint Wealth & others)
- Pros: Helps build CIBIL score, even for low-income individuals
- Cons: Higher interest for first-time users
Ideal For: Salaried individuals earning above ₹12,000/month.

❓ FAQs
Q1. Are instant loan apps safe?
Yes, as long as the lender is RBI registered. Avoid apps not listed on the RBI-approved NBFC list.

Q2. Can I get a loan with low CIBIL?
Some apps like Nira and KreditBee approve even if your score is low, but interest rates may be higher.

Q3. What documents are needed?
PAN, Aadhaar, salary slips or bank statements. Some offer KYC via DigiLocker.
